@charset "utf-8";
/* CSS Document */
body {
	font-family:Verdana, Arial, Helvetica, sans-serif;
	font-size: 12px;
	font-weight: normal;
	color: #000000;
	background-color: #e3dfd3;
	margin:0px;
	padding:0px;
}
 
 /* standard elements */

h1 {
	color:#990000;
	letter-spacing:5px;
	font-size:16px;
	font-weight:bold;
	text-align:center;
	padding: 0px;
	margin-top: 10px;
	margin-right: 0px;
	margin-bottom: 4px;
	margin-left: 0px;
	font-style: normal;
	text-transform: none;
}
h2{
	color:#990000;
	letter-spacing:5px;
	font-size:16px;
	font-weight:bold;
	text-align:center;
	padding: 0px;
	margin-top: 10px;
	margin-right: 0px;
	margin-bottom: 4px;
	margin-left: 0px;
	font-style: normal;
	text-transform: none;
	clear:both;
}
h3.tagline{
	font-size:13px;
	font-weight:normal;
	font-style:italic;
	text-align:center;
	padding:0px;
	margin-top: 0px;
	margin-right: 0px;
	margin-bottom: 4px;
	margin-left: 0px;
	letter-spacing: 2px;
}
h2.wmgloves{
 	color:#990000;
	font-size:13px;
	font-weight:bold;
	font-style:normal;
	text-align:left;
	padding:0px;
	margin-top: 0px;
	margin-right: 0px;
	margin-bottom: 4px;
	margin-left: 0px;
	letter-spacing: 2px;
}
p {
 text-align:justify;
}

/* Main elements */
#glove {
	margin:auto;
	background-image:url(./images_sc/backgroundGlow.png);
	width:766px;
	background-color:#e3dfd3;
}

#topFrame {
	width:766px; height:10px; 
	clear:both; 
	font-size:2px; 
	background-color:#e3dfd3; background-image:url(../images_sc/backgroundGlowTop.png);
}
#bottomFrame{
width:766px; height:10px; 
	clear:both; 
	font-size:2px; 
	background-color:#e3dfd3; background-image:url(../images_sc/backgroundGlowBottom.png);
}

#main {
	margin:auto;
	width:750px;
}

/* Header / logo */
#logoBox {
	margin:auto;
	width:750px;
	clear:both;
}
#logoBottom {
	height:33px;
	background-color:#e3dfd3; background-image:url(./images_sc/header_tan_02.png);
	width:750px;
}

#logoBottom a {
font-size:10px;
 color:#000000;
 float:right;
 margin-right:8px;
 position:relative;
 top:8px;
}

/* content */
#content {
	width:750px;
	background-color:#FFFFFF;
	padding-top:10px;
}




.page{
	width:730px;
	margin:auto;
	padding-top:10px;
	padding-bottom:10px;
	border-top:solid 1px #CCCCCC;
	clear:both;
}

/* Feature Glove */
.featuredBox{
	width:540px;
	margin:auto;
	padding-top:10px;
	padding-bottom:10px;
	border-top:solid 1px #CCCCCC;
	clear:both;
}

.featuredDesc{
 width:360px;
 float:right;
 margin-right:6px;
}
.featuredDesc a{
 color:#990000;
 padding:10px;
 text-decoration:none;
}
.featuredDesc a:hover{
 text-decoration:underline;
}

.featuredBox img{
border:solid 3px #ffffff;
position:relative;
top:12px;
margin-bottom:14px;
}
.featuredBox img:hover{
border:solid 3px #990000;
}

.featuredBox h2 {
	font-size:14px;
	color:#990000;
	text-align:left;
	letter-spacing:1px;
	text-transform:none;
	font-style:normal;
	font-weight:bold;
}

.featuredBox p{
line-height:18px;
}


/* Press Glove */
.pressBox{
	width:540px;
	margin:auto;
	padding-top:20px;
	padding-bottom:10px;
	border-top:solid 1px #CCCCCC;
	clear:both;
}
.pressBox h2 {
	font-size:18px;
	color:#990000;
	text-align:center;
	letter-spacing:1px;
	text-transform:none;
	width:490px;
	margin:auto;
	margin-bottom:10px;
	font-style:normal;
	font-weight:bold;
}
.pressBox p{
 text-align:center;
 margin:auto;
 width:490px;
 line-height:18px;
 padding-bottom:10px;
}
.pressBox a{
 color:#990000;
 font-weight:normal;
 text-decoration:none;
}
.pressBox a:hover{
 text-decoration:underline;
}
.pressBoxSection{
	width:100%;
	clear:both;
	padding-bottom:20px;
}


/* about us */
.aboutUs{
 width:540px;
 float:right;
 margin-right:9px;
}

.aboutUs a{
 color:#990000;
 font-weight:bold;
}

/* What's New */
.wnewBox{
	width:540px;
	margin:auto;
	padding-top:20px;
	padding-bottom:20px;
	border-top:solid 1px #CCCCCC;
	clear:both;
}

.wnewBox h3{
	font-size:18px;
	color:#990000;
	text-align:center;
	letter-spacing:1px;
	text-transform:none;
	width:490px;
	margin:auto;
	margin-bottom:10px;
}
.wnewBox h2{
 margin:0px;
 margin-bottom: 2px;
 padding:0px;
 height:12px;
 padding-top:16px;
 color:#333333;
 font-weight:bold;
 text-align:left;
 font-style:normal;
 letter-spacing:1px;
 font-size:14px;
}


	
.wnewBox p{
 margin-top:10px;
 padding-top:10px;
 line-height:18px;
}

/* Top banner / Links */
#toplinksec	{
	background-color: #990000; 
	border-top:solid 4px #000000; border-bottom:solid 4px #000000;
	clear:both;
}
#topbannermenu {
	font-size: 10px; text-align:center; 
	background-image:url(./images_sc/footer_background.png); 
	border-top:solid 1px #efe593; border-bottom:solid 1px #efe593;
	height:16px;
	padding-top:4px;
}
#topbannermenu	a 	{color:#efe593; font-size:10px; padding-left:10px; text-decoration: none;}
#topbannermenu	a:hover 	{color:#ffffb3; text-decoration:underline;}


/* Bottom Footer / Links */
#botlinksec	{
	background-color: #990000; 
	color:#bba050;
	border-top:solid 4px #000000; border-bottom:solid 4px #000000;
	clear:both;
}
#botbannermenu {
	font-size: 10px; text-align:center; 
	background-image:url(./images_sc/footer_background.png); 
	border-top:solid 1px #efe593; border-bottom:solid 1px #efe593;
	height:34px;
	padding-top:3px;
}
#botbannermenu	a 	{color:#efe593; font-size:10px; padding-left:6px; padding-right:6px; text-decoration: none; line-height:16px;}
#botbannermenu	a:hover 	{color:#ffffb3; text-decoration:underline;}

#copyright{
 height:28px;
 width:500px;
 clear:both;
 margin:auto;
 text-align:center;
 font-size:11px;
 color:#660000;
}

.spacer{
width:700px;
clear:both;
height:20px;
}

/* MENU */
#menuBox{
 float:left;
 width:168px;
 margin-top:10px;
 overflow:auto;
}

#menuBox h3{
 font-size:12px;
 font-weight:bold;
 color:#990000;
 border-bottom:solid 1px #CCCCCC;
 width:100%;
 margin-bottom:6px;
}

#menuBox .top{
	padding-top:0; margin-top:0;
}

#menuBox a {
	color:#000000;
	text-decoration:none;
	font-size:11px;
	line-height: 18px;
}

#menuBox a:hover {
 color:#000000;
 text-decoration:underline;
}

#menuAdd{
margin-bottom:10px;
}

#menuBox ul{
	padding:0;
	margin:0;
	list-style:none;
}

#menuBox ul li{
	background-image:url(images_sc/bullet.gif);
	background-repeat:no-repeat;
	background-position: 0px 60%; 
	padding-left:8px;
	margin:0;
}

.menuBoxSec{
	clear:both;
	padding-top:20px;
}

.cent{ text-align:center; }

#ccHdBox {width:100%; height:24px; clear:both;  }
#ccHdBox a { text-decoration:none; font-weight: bold; font-family:Arial; font-size:16px; color:#990000; }

#ccEmBox {font-family:Arial,Helvetica,sans-serif;font-size:10px;color:#999999;}
#ccEmBox a {font-family:Arial,Helvetica,sans-serif;font-size:10px;color:#999999;}

/*index page menu */
.pageMenu {
 width:100%; height:40px;
 margin:auto;
 clear:both;
 color:#FFF;
 border-top:solid 1px #CCC;
}
.pageMenu a {
 float:left;
 padding:11px;
 font-size:13px;
 color:#544;
 text-decoration:none;
}
.pageMenu a:hover { text-decoration:underline; color:#900; }

/* testimonials */
.spacerLine{
 width:520px;
 height:10px;
 clear:both;
 margin:auto;
 margin-bottom:20px;
 border-bottom:solid 1px #CCCCCC;
}

/* searchbox */
.searchforms {background-color: #000000; color: #FFFFFF; font-family: Verdana, Arial, Helvetica, sans-serif; font-size: 10px; font-weight: normal; background-color:#FFFFFF; color:#000000; width:140px; padding:0;}
.searchinput     	{font-family: Verdana, Arial, Helvetica, sans-serif; color: #000000; font-size: 11px; font-weight: normal; background-color:#FFFFFF; width: 100px}
.buttonsstandard		{font-size:10px; font-weight: bold; font-family: Verdana, Arial, Helvetica, sans-serif; margin-left: 1px; margin-top: 1px;margin-bottom: 1px; margin-right: 1px; border-style:solid; border-width:1px; 
width:90px; height:20px; text-align:center; cursor:pointer;}
